Wipro Limited (NYSE:WIT - Get Free Report) shares traded down 4.7% during trading on Thursday . The stock traded as low as $2.87 and last traded at $2.93. 3,783,295 shares traded hands during trading, a decline of 32% from the average session volume of 5,570,259 shares. The stock had previously closed at $3.07.

Wipro Company Profile
(
Get Free Report)
Wipro Limited operates as an information technology (IT), consulting, and business process services company worldwide. It operates through IT Services and IT Products segments. The IT Services segment offers IT and IT-enabled services, including digital strategy advisory, customer-centric design, technology and IT consulting, custom application design, development, re-engineering and maintenance, systems integration, package implementation, cloud and infrastructure, business process, cloud, mobility and analytics, research and development, and hardware and software design services to enterprises.
